The making of action films is a fascinating process. From cutting-edge technology to meticulous stunt work, these movies require a team of skilled professionals to bring them to life. Here are some behind-the-scenes secrets:
1. Technological Advancements: Action movies are constantly pushing the boundaries of filmmaking technology. Motion-capture, visual effects, and high-speed cameras allow filmmakers to create stunts and sequences that were once impossible.
2. Stunt Coordinators: Masters of Action Stunt coordinators play a vital role in action films, ensuring the safety and authenticity of the action sequences. They work closely with actors, stunt doubles, and directors to design and execute thrilling and believable stunts.
3. Physical Training: Actors Embracing Action To portray action-packed roles convincingly, actors undergo rigorous physical training to build strength, endurance, and flexibility. This training can involve intense workouts, fight choreography, and weapon handling.
